Implementation of a Research-Based Curriculum in NSU’s Biochemistry Labs

    Research output: Contribution to conferencePresentation

    Abstract

    Recently, the biochemistry course at NSU has been redeveloped from a cookbook set of labs to an integrated research based curriculum and in the process received designation as the first ExEL course in the Chemistry and Physics department. This presentation will focus on implementation of course based undergraduate research experiences (CUREs) through the lens of the biochemistry lab course. A special focus will be placed on benefit to students and assessment deign.
